Faulty Cooking Area Sink


The cooking area sink is an important and also a lot of utilized part of the kitchen area. It is vulnerable to water damage; problems such as blocked pipelines, leaking pipes, and damaged taps.
These damages can be bothersome, especially when one is busy in the cooking area. Nevertheless, it doesn't just occur without giving a clue or a sign. So here are some signs to understand when your sink is not alright
  • When draining water into the skin makes a gurgling sound and also produces air bubbles while going through the sink. It indicates that something is obstructing the pipes of the sink.

  • Another indication of a blocked drainpipe is the sluggish activity of water. Normally, water passes through a sink right away, so if you start noticing hold-up, there is an obstruction in the pipes.

  • The following sign is an offensive smell; this reveals that the pipelines are blocked, and also stale food is piling in the pipelines. This problem calls for a quick fix, so the smell does not surpass your home.

  • Dripping pipes as well as taps additionally can be an issue. It makes your kitchen area damp and untidy, particularly when trickling from the pipes. As well as if it is dripping from the faucet, it brings about water wastage.

    Dripping Dishwasher


    Dishwashing machines make life in the kitchen less complicated. Nonetheless, it is an optional kitchen home appliance as well as, when readily available, can be a source of water damage. In addition, like other makers, it will certainly create faults with time, even with upkeep.
    Among the mistakes is dripping via the door or under the dish washer. These mistakes develop due to age, fractures, wrong usage, loose links to pipes, etc.
    Faults due to age come from continuous use. Therefore, the door leaks due to opening and closing.
    Mistakes from the incorrect use might cause water damage by introducing cracks to it. Hence, it is advisable to follow the hand-operated overview of the dishwasher to prevent this particular damages.
    The leaks under the dishwasher can come from splits in the gasket, tube, as well as loose or wrong connection to water pipes or drains.
    This sort of leakage commonly goes unnoticed and can be there for a long time. However, as a result of the moment frame, it can cause and also harm the floor mold development.
    Extra so, the longer the water stays, you will notice the bending of the floor where the dishwasher is. This is an excellent indication to watch out for when checking if your dishwashing machine leaks. Finding and also fixing this on time prevents significant water damage to your flooring.

    What causes kitchen flooding?


    Kitchens can flood for numerous reasons, some of which are out of the homeowner’s control. Overflowing sinks, for example, are just one cause of a kitchen flood. Clogs can send wastewater back up through the sink drain and into the kitchen.



    Furthermore, kitchen faucets can leak when the pipes around the water supply line become corroded. Pipes can loosen or crack, and even new PVC pipes are vulnerable to developing small cracks. When gaskets wear out along areas where the pipe meets the faucet, leaks and subsequent flooding can occur.



    How to clean up kitchen flood?


    If the flooded area is not severe, you may be able to dry it out yourself with a mop and bucket; however, for larger areas, don’t hesitate to call a water damage restoration professional. In addition, if you can see that the problem has been ongoing for a few days or more, you will want to contact a mold remediation professional as it is likely that the fungus has developed over time. But while waiting for the technicians to arrive, you can get a head start on the drying process by taking the following steps:


  • Remove all excess water. If you have a shop vac that is able to remove water, this would be the most efficient tool. Otherwise, a mop and a bucket will be handy.


  • Increase air flow. After the excess water has been removed, it is likely that the building materials and furnishings are still wet. To dry them out, turn on the air conditioner or dehumidifier. If weather conditions are dry, open the exterior windows to allow for additional air to circulate the property. However, if sewage water has seeped into the air conditioning unit, do not use it.


  • Open drawers and cabinets. Moisture can easily accumulate within these smaller areas; be sure that they are all open to allow dry air to flow throughout the space.


  • Avoid damaged electrical items. If any kitchen appliances, such as the toaster, blender, microwave, oven, etc. have been damaged by the water, do not use them. Have them inspected by a professional to determine if they are safe to reuse.


  • Do not lay down magazines or newspaper. Although paper is quick to retain water, the ink will quickly bleed onto the floor and cause a bigger mess.


  • Dry off wet furniture. If any upholstery has been damaged from the water, wipe them down thoroughly. But be careful when drying off wood furniture; this type of material becomes severely weakened after having contact with water.


  • How to Clean Wet Cabinets in a Flooded Kitchen


    A flood caused by any of the abovementioned scenarios will lead to water damaged kitchen cabinets. Cleaning the water damaged cabinets right away is important since water damage spreads quickly. Whether the cabinets are made of wood or plywood, proper cleaning tactics help salvage them.



    Upon removing the standing water, remove the cabinet doors and dry them with a household fan. Keep the cabinet doors flat to prevent warping. The cabinets should also be dried—however, with multiple high-volume fans and a dehumidifier that run over the course of one full day.
